1、以oracle系统用户登陆,设置当前实例
export ORACLE_SID=CRMtest
或用vi来编辑profile文件
/home/oracle > vi .profile
export ORACLE_SID = CRM64/crmtest
wq
2、查看设置的实例是否为要启动的实例
echo $ORACLE_SID --查看当前Oracle实例的sid
3、以DBA的身份登陆到sqlplus
sqlplus "/as sysdba"
4、启动数据库实例
startup
5、停止数据库实例
shutdown
6、如果连接数据库提示ORA-15241 则说明监听没有启动(一般会在linux下先启动监听器,再启动sqlplus来启动实例)
lsnrctl status 检查监听是否启动
lsnrctl start 启动监听
分享到:
相关推荐
2. 切换到需要启动的数据库实例下:export ORACLE_SID=orcl 3. 使用 oracle 账号登陆 Linux 系统:#oracle #passwd:oraclepass 4. 启动数据库实例:#sqlplus /nolog #conn /as sysdba #startup #exit 5. 启动实例...
2. 输入以下命令来启动Oracle数据库实例: ``` @echo off rem 设置ORACLE_HOME和PATH环境变量 set ORACLE_HOME=C:\Oracle\product\12.1.0\dbhome_1 set PATH=%ORACLE_HOME%\bin;%PATH% rem 启动数据库服务 ...
下面是启动Oracle数据库多实例的步骤: 1. 启动监听:使用lsnrctl start语句启动数据库监听服务。 2. 切换到Oracle用户:使用su - oracle语句切换到Oracle用户。 3. 设置当前Oracle_SID:使用export ORACLE_SID=...
启动Oracle数据库实例需要遵循以下步骤: 1. 启动数据库监听服务:使用命令`lsnrctl start`启动数据库监听服务。 2. 切换到需要启动的数据库实例下:使用命令`export ORACLE_SID=orcl`切换到orcl数据库实例下,如果...
1. 在企业的 Oracle 数据库服务器中,运行“cmd”启动到命令行,设置 Oracle_sid 变量,运行“sqlplus /nolog”,连接到 Oracle 数据库实例。 2. 获取 Oracle 数据库实例的实例名、控制文件位置、数据文件位置、重做...
### Linux下新建Oracle数据库实例教程 #### 一、引言 在Linux环境下部署和管理Oracle数据库实例是一项重要的技能,尤其对于那些希望利用Linux强大的稳定性和安全性来运行关键业务应用程序的企业而言。本文档将详细...
6. 启动Oracle数据库实例和监听器。 结论 本文主要从Linux操作系统下Oracle数据库的安装和设计方案出发,阐述了Oracle数据库的系统结构和工作机理,并提出了六个方面的优化调整方案。希望本文能够为读者提供有价值...
1. **启动Oracle数据库实例的shell脚本**: 这个脚本 `/oracle/home/bin/dbstart` 使用 `sqlplus` 命令以 `sysdba` 权限连接到数据库,并执行 `startup` 命令来启动数据库实例。`sqlplus / as sysdba` 是以系统管理...
本文将深入讲解Oracle数据库实例的概念,以及数据库与实例之间的关系,并提供启动、挂载、打开、关闭和卸载数据库实例的基本步骤。 Oracle数据库实例由一组后台进程和一个共享内存区域组成,这些进程和内存区域在同...
本文将详述如何手工创建一个Oracle数据库实例,这对于数据库开发程序员来说是一项基础且重要的技能。 首先,理解“数据库实例”至关重要。Oracle数据库实例是运行在操作系统上的内存结构和进程的集合,它与实际的...
首先,Oracle数据库实例是Oracle数据库管理系统在内存中运行的实体,它负责管理数据库的运行和访问。在创建实例之前,必须启动Oracle的监听服务——OracleOraDb11g_home1TNSListener。监听器是Oracle网络架构的一...
本文将详细介绍如何在一台服务器上启动多个Oracle数据库实例,并提供一种方法来实现这些实例的自动启动。 #### 二、手动启动多个Oracle数据库实例 假设在同一台机器上有两个数据库实例DB1和DB2,以下是一种手动...
创建Oracle实例通常涉及到启动Oracle数据库服务,这涉及到操作系统级别的操作,如启动数据库服务器进程。在Unix/Linux环境中,这可能通过`sqlplus /nolog`然后`connect as sysdba`来实现,接着执行`startup`命令启动...
#### 一、Oracle数据库实例概念解析 **Oracle数据库实例**是指一组管理数据库文件的存储结构。简单来说,一个运行中的Oracle数据库背后实际上是一个实例,这个实例负责管理和提供对数据库文件的访问。 #### 二、...
使用startup命令启动Oracle数据库实例。 SQL> startup; 这将启动数据库实例,并显示当前数据库的状态信息。 修改系统用户密码 使用alter user命令修改sys用户和system用户的密码。 SQL> alter user sys ...
### Oracle数据库、实例、用户、表空间的关系解析 #### 一、Oracle数据库概述 Oracle数据库是一种高度复杂的数据库管理系统,主要用于企业级数据管理和处理。与其他数据库系统不同,Oracle数据库中的“数据库”这一...
Oracle 12c数据库实例管理是 DBA 的核心工作之一,本文将从数据库版本号、参数对比、安装环境、启动数据库阶段等方面详细介绍实战管理Oracle 12c数据库实例的知识点。 1. 数据库版本号 Oracle数据库版本号由五个...
Oracle实例的创建涉及到初始化参数文件(init.ora)的配置,通过启动Oracle数据库服务来启动实例。实例的监控则通过各种性能指标和工具进行,例如使用SQL*Plus的V$视图或者企业管理器(EM)来查看实例的状态、资源...
重启Oracle数据库通常涉及两个主要步骤:停止数据库实例(如果尚未关闭)和重新启动监听器以及数据库实例。以下是几种常见的重启方法: **方法1:使用`dbstart`和`lsnrctl`命令** 1. 以root用户登录Linux系统。 2. ...